About the venue
Liberty State Park in Jersey City spans over 1,200 acres, offering breathtaking views of the Manhattan skyline and the Statue of Liberty. Established in 1976, it features extensive waterfront walkways, picnic areas, and recreational facilities for various outdoor activities. The park is a popular destination for both locals and tourists, providing a perfect spot for walking, cycling, or enjoying a casual picnic. Seasonal events and festivals often take place, enhancing the park's community appeal.
